Description

The Honeywell T-Hawk is an unmanned micro air vehicle (MAV) that provides real-time situational awareness in critical situations. It made its arrival in combat in 2007 and leads the industry in micro unmanned aerial vehicles (UAVs) as the first model with hover and stare capability in a wide range of weather conditions. The T-Hawk MAVfeatures real-time video documentation to support advanced intelligence, surveillance and reconnaissance (ISR). Its easy to assemble; its airborne within 10 minutes; and it provides a smooth vertical takeoff and landing. The Honeywell T-Hawk MAV supports a broad range of missions including: IED identification and monitoring Target acquisition and damage assessment Homeland Security Disaster surveillance and damage assessment operations Autonomous flights with dynamic re-tasking and manual intervention The Honeywell T-Hawk MAV Features: 24/7 operations, day or night, in diverse environments such as salt, sand, dust or fog Flexible payload uses gimbaled EO and IR imaging sensors in a modular, interchangeable package Climbs at a rate of 25 feet per second up to 10,000 feet Flies up to 50 miles per hour 46 minutes of battery life Weighs under 20 pounds and fits in a backpack Adaptable flight planning with up to 100 waypoints per flight plan and up to 10 pre-planned flight plans stored on the ground station
